首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php写配制文件

基础概念

PHP 配置文件通常指的是 php.ini 文件,它是 PHP 解释器的配置文件,用于设置 PHP 运行时的各种选项和参数。通过修改 php.ini 文件,可以控制 PHP 的行为,如内存限制、上传文件大小、时区设置等。

相关优势

  1. 灵活性:可以根据应用需求调整 PHP 的配置,以优化性能和安全性。
  2. 集中管理:所有 PHP 配置集中在一个文件中,便于管理和维护。
  3. 安全性:可以通过配置文件限制某些功能,提高应用的安全性。

类型

PHP 配置文件主要分为以下几类:

  1. 全局配置文件:通常位于 PHP 安装目录下的 php.ini 文件,对所有 PHP 进程生效。
  2. 局部配置文件:可以通过 php.ini 文件中的 include_path 选项包含其他配置文件,实现局部配置。

应用场景

  1. Web 服务器:在 Apache 或 Nginx 等 Web 服务器中,通过修改 php.ini 文件来配置 PHP。
  2. 命令行工具:在使用 PHP 命令行工具时,也可以通过 php.ini 文件进行配置。
  3. 框架集成:一些 PHP 框架(如 Laravel)也会使用或扩展 php.ini 文件的配置。

遇到的问题及解决方法

问题:修改 php.ini 文件后,配置没有生效

原因

  1. 缓存问题:某些配置更改需要重启 Web 服务器或 PHP-FPM 服务才能生效。
  2. 路径问题:确保修改的是正确的 php.ini 文件。
  3. 语法错误:配置文件中的语法错误可能导致配置不生效。

解决方法

  1. 重启服务:重启 Web 服务器或 PHP-FPM 服务。
  2. 重启服务:重启 Web 服务器或 PHP-FPM 服务。
  3. 检查路径:使用 php --ini 命令查看当前使用的 php.ini 文件路径。
  4. 检查路径:使用 php --ini 命令查看当前使用的 php.ini 文件路径。
  5. 验证语法:使用 php --ini 命令检查 php.ini 文件的语法。
  6. 验证语法:使用 php --ini 命令检查 php.ini 文件的语法。

示例代码

假设我们需要修改 memory_limitupload_max_filesize 参数:

代码语言:txt
复制
; 修改内存限制为 256MB
memory_limit = 256M

; 修改上传文件大小限制为 20MB
upload_max_filesize = 20M

总结

PHP 配置文件 php.ini 是 PHP 运行时的重要配置文件,通过它可以灵活地调整 PHP 的行为。在修改配置文件时,需要注意缓存、路径和语法等问题,确保配置能够正确生效。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券